Indonesia as one of the largest nickel producers in the world has regulations regarding nickel exports. This is stated in the Regulation of the Minister of Energy and Mineral Resources Number 11 of 2019 concerning the Second Amendment to the Regulation of the Minister of Energy and Mineral Resources Number 25 of 2018 concerning Mineral and Coal Mining Business Activities. In the regulation, Indonesia imposed a ban on nickel ore exports. Regarding this ban, the European Union reacted by filing a lawsuit with the World Trade Organization (WTO). Based on the State sovereignty & Theory of Welfare State, the state must actively strive for welfare, and act fairly that can be felt by all people evenly and in balance. Therefore, the implementation of a ban or restriction on nickel ore exports is a way for the Indonesian government to improve people’s welfare. The narrative of national sovereignty and welfare state can be used as an argument in front of the WTO international forum but accompanied by a strong legal basis argument by using Article XIX of GATT 1994 regarding the exception in economic circumstances, a safeguard measure against domestic industry when there is a surge in imports that causes or threatens to cause serious losses.
